INDIAN SCHOOL SOHAR CELEBRATES THE 51st NATIONAL DAY OF OMAN

21-11-2021

Indian School Sohar celebrated the 51st National Day of the Sultanate of Oman, which is a commemorative day to celebrate the birthday of the late Sultan Qaboos Bin Said. The school has been decked up in the national colours of green, red, and white for the special day. The festoons,  flags and smiles on the faces of the students and staff made it known to everyone that the day was special. The staff and students were seen exchanging greetings, spreading cheer all around.

However, since a circular has been issued to schools prohibiting any events or gatherings on this occasion, the red-letter day was celebrated virtually with great enthusiasm.

There was no stone left unturned as students from Kindergarten to grade 12 took part in the virtual celebration of this prestigious event by organizing special assemblies. Students showcased their talents by reading poetry, singing, dancing, and showing off the beautiful Omani traditional dress in which they were dressed up for the occasion. A special PPT- Oman Vision 2040 by the Oman TV was shown to the students to raise more awareness among them about the country where they are residing, and which has become their home away from their homeland.

Principal Sanchita Verma expressed her gratitude to His Majesty Sultan Haitham Bin Tariq and  the friendly people of the country. She greeted her Omani colleagues on this special day.
